The third volume of the 'd'Artagnan Romances', of which «The Three Musketeers» and «Twenty Years After» constitute the first and second volumes, was first serialized between October 1847 to January 1850. It has subsequently been published in three, four, and five-volume editions. Our edition follows the four-volume edition. The first of two sequels written for «The Three Musketeers,» Dumas' beloved characters return for more adventurous duty in «Twenty Years After.» As the title suggests, two decades have elapsed since D'Artagnan and his friends have prevailed over the evil machinations of Cardinal Richelieu and the icy Milady. However, danger and political intrigue still abound in both France and England, where the former is on the brink of civil war and the latter is nearly in the control of Cromwell....
Urbain Grandier (* 1590 – † 1634) war ein französischer katholischer Priester, der in der Angelegenheit um die sogenannten Teufel von Loudun wegen Hexerei verurteilt und auf dem Scheiterhaufen verbrannt wurde. Grandier war Priester in der Kirche Sainte Croix in Loudun im Bistum Poitiers.
